1963 40HP 'rude. Starts and runs great for the first 5-10 minutes, after which it starts to slow down. It will then run well at about 1/4 throttle, but die if I try to give it any more. Feels like fuel starvation..? Any ideas..?

Get a spray bottle & put some pre mix in it. Go for a run and when it starts to slow down squirt some fuel into the carb. If it picks up that confirms that you have a fuel supply problem. I would suspect crud in the carb & time for a rebuild.

ditto, carb is probably fouled. When rebuilding it, get a rebuild kit that includes a new plastic float. the old cork floats don't survive with todays fuels.
